求问下node.color.setA这个API

image 请看下这段代码,这样写有啥问题吗?

按照代码提审说是设置当前的透明度。但是测试这种用法完全无效?image

有两个问题:

  1. node的透明度不能通过Color设置只能通过opacity设置
  2. 修改node的color必须直接对node的color赋与新值,不能通过修改color的属性,直接修改color的属性无法触发Node监听的事件导致不会生效!
    截屏2025-11-10 17.39.39

QQ_1762769847052
首先这个方法是在color下的,创建color后,可以通过这个方法修改,但是这个不是节点下的方法,节点的颜色赋值需要直接赋值color,节点的透明度通过opacity设置,修改color的alpha值并不会生效

🤦‍多个项目穿插着搞,搞得头昏脑胀,居然犯了这种错误